Sincona sale 98, lot 4599

This specimen was lot 4599 in SINCONA Auction 98 (Zürich, May 2025), where it sold for 900 CHF (about US$1,306 including buyers' fees). The catalog description[1] noted,

"SCHWEIZ Zug, Stadt und Kanton, 1/6 Assis 1756, Zug. Zugerwappen in deutschem Schild. Rv. Fünf Zeilen Schrift, Jahreszahl und Beizeichen. Selten. Fast sehr schön. Exemplar der Slg. Kunzmann, Auktion SINCONA 44, Zürich, Oktober 2017, aus Los 6000. (Switzerland, city and canton of Zug, one-sixth assis of 1756, Zug mint. Obverse: cantonal arms in German shield; reverse: five line inscription with date. Rare, About Very Fine.)"

The SCWC lists this type for 1747-52, 1756-57, 1761-67. Like many low denomination coins, it is common in low grade but rare in choice condition, no contemporaries thinking it worth hoarding. It was equal to the angster (1/600 thaler).

Recorded mintage: unknown.

Specifications: 0.2 g, billon, 12 mm diameter, this specimen 0.22 g.

Catalog reference: KM 56, Tobler (1/6 Assis) 23c (plate coin). Wielandt (Zug) 132. D.T. 645f, HMZ 2-1105w.
